2. Drain Dimension Compatibility

The effectiveness of a bathe pan leak take a look at hinges considerably on drain measurement compatibility with the chosen testing equipment. Drain measurement compatibility is a vital design and choice parameter for a “bathe pan take a look at plug”. A plug designed for a 2-inch drain, when used with a 1.5-inch drain, will fail to create a watertight seal. Conversely, making an attempt to drive an outsized plug right into a smaller drain can injury the drainpipe itself. This incompatibility renders the leak take a look at invalid and creates potential for additional problems.

Producers supply plugs in a spread of ordinary drain sizes, sometimes 1.5 inches, 2 inches, and three inches, to accommodate various plumbing configurations. Some fashions supply adjustable or expandable options to offer a level of flexibility throughout totally different drain sizes. Cautious measurement of the drain opening is important earlier than deciding on a “bathe pan take a look at plug”. Failure to make sure correct sizing undermines the reliability of the leak take a look at, probably leading to undetected leaks and subsequent water injury. For example, in older houses, drain sizes could not conform to fashionable requirements, necessitating the usage of specialised or adjustable plugs.

The power to accurately match the testing plug to the drain measurement is a prerequisite for correct and efficient bathe pan leak testing. 5. Leak Detection

Efficient detection of leaks inside a bathe pan set up is the first perform facilitated by a bathe pan testing equipment. The take a look at plug, by creating a brief, watertight seal within the drain, allows the filling of the bathe pan with water, making a managed atmosphere for figuring out breaches within the pan’s waterproof barrier. If the water stage decreases over a specified interval, it signifies a leak. The power to precisely determine such leaks at this stage is crucial, stopping water injury to subflooring, adjoining partitions, and ceilings under. Failure to conduct correct leak detection could end in vital structural repairs and remediation prices down the road. For instance, with out this testing process, a pinhole leak in a bathe pan liner may go unnoticed, resulting in sluggish however persistent water seepage that fosters mildew progress and rots wood framing.

Steadily Requested Questions

This part addresses widespread inquiries relating to the utilization of a bathe pan testing equipment. The data supplied goals to make clear greatest practices and improve understanding of leak testing procedures.

Query 1: What’s the typical period for a bathe pan leak take a look at utilizing a take a look at plug?

The usual period for a bathe pan leak take a look at sometimes ranges from 24 to 72 hours. Native plumbing codes or producer specs could dictate the precise period. The pan must be stuffed to the overflow stage and monitored for any drop in water stage throughout this era.

Query 2: How does one decide the right measurement of the testing plug wanted for a selected drain?

The drain opening’s internal diameter should be measured to find out the right measurement of the testing plug. Normal drain sizes are sometimes 1.5 inches, 2 inches, or 3 inches. Choose a plug particularly designed for the measured drain measurement to make sure a safe and watertight seal.

Query 3: What supplies are generally used within the building of bathe pan testing plugs, and which is most sturdy?

Widespread supplies embody rubber, expandable polymers, and PVC. Expandable polymers usually supply superior sturdiness on account of their resistance to chemical degradation and temperature fluctuations. The precise utility dictates probably the most acceptable materials alternative.

Query 4: Can a bathe pan leak take a look at be carried out with out a specialised testing plug?

Whereas different strategies exist, a specialised testing plug offers probably the most dependable and safe seal for correct leak detection. Improvised options could not present a watertight seal, probably resulting in false negatives or unreliable take a look at outcomes.

Query 5: What are the important thing indicators of a failed bathe pan leak take a look at?

A lower within the water stage throughout the testing interval, dampness or water stains on the underside of the bathe pan, or water seepage across the drainpipe all point out a failed take a look at. Any of those indicators necessitate additional investigation and restore.

Query 6: Are there particular security precautions to watch when conducting a bathe pan leak take a look at?

Make sure the bathe pan is sufficiently supported to bear the load of the water. Keep away from overfilling the pan, and monitor the take a look at space for any indicators of structural stress. Put on acceptable private protecting gear, akin to gloves and eye safety, to attenuate publicity to potential contaminants.

Important Steering for Bathe Pan Leak Testing

This part outlines essential tips for maximizing the effectiveness of bathe pan leak assessments utilizing a chosen testing equipment. Adherence to those factors ensures correct outcomes and minimizes the danger of water injury.

Tip 1: Choose the Applicable Plug Dimension: Confirm the drain’s internal diameter earlier than selecting a take a look at plug. Utilizing an incorrectly sized plug compromises the watertight seal, invalidating the take a look at outcomes. Producers sometimes point out the drain measurement compatibility on the packaging.

Tip 2: Guarantee Correct Drain Cleanliness: Completely clear the drainpipe earlier than inserting the take a look at plug. Particles or obstructions can forestall a safe seal, resulting in inaccurate leak detection. Use an appropriate drain cleaner or brush to take away any buildup.

Tip 3: Keep away from Over-Tightening the Plug: Over-tightening the growth mechanism of the take a look at plug can injury the drainpipe or the plug itself. Observe the producer’s really useful torque or tightening tips to realize a correct seal with out extreme drive.

Tip 4: Fill the Bathe Pan to the Overflow Stage: To successfully take a look at for leaks, fill the bathe pan with water to the overflow stage. This ensures that each one potential leak factors, together with the drain connection and the pan’s perimeter, are adequately submerged.

Tip 5: Permit Adequate Testing Time: Adhere to the really useful testing period specified by native plumbing codes or the bathe pan producer. A minimal of 24 hours is often required for correct leak detection, permitting adequate time for even minor leaks to manifest.

Tip 6: Monitor the Water Stage Rigorously: Carefully observe the water stage within the bathe pan all through the testing interval. A big drop in water stage signifies a leak and necessitates additional investigation. Account for potential evaporation when deciphering the outcomes.

Tip 7: Examine the Underside of the Bathe Pan: Throughout and after the testing interval, examine the underside of the bathe pan and the encompassing areas for any indicators of dampness or water stains. These indicators affirm the presence of a leak, even when the water stage within the pan stays comparatively fixed.

Following these tips helps make sure the correct and dependable detection of leaks throughout bathe pan set up. By implementing these measures, potential water injury and dear repairs are mitigated.
